Occupation Profile: Ensign in the Military

An ensign is an officer rank within the military that often signifies the first steps in a military career. This role requires not only physical ability but also leadership qualities and the ability to make quick decisions under pressure.

Job Duties and Responsibilities

As an ensign, your main tasks are to lead and organize military operations. This can involve everything from planning and conducting exercises to leading a troop in the field. Leadership and the ability to collaborate are central aspects of the job, where one is also expected to act as a role model for younger soldiers.

Education and Requirements

To become an ensign in the military, one must undergo an officer training at the Military Academy. This education combines theoretical studies with practical exercises and is designed to strengthen both physical and leadership skills. After completing the training, often funded by the state, one receives an officer's degree and can begin their service as an ensign.

Salary Statistics and Development

The average salary for an ensign in the military is 49 400 SEK per month. Salary differences exist between genders where men earn an average of 49 900 SEK while women earn 44 100 SEK, meaning that women earn 88% of what men do. There has been a positive salary development from the previous year where the average salary was 47 500 SEK.

About the data

All information displayed on this page is based on data from the Swedish Central Bureau of Statistics (SCB), the Swedish Tax Agency and the Swedish employment agency. Learn more about our data and data sources here.

All figures are gross salaries, meaning salaries before tax. The average salary, or mean salary, is calculated by adding up the total salary for all individuals within the profession and dividing it by the number of individuals. For specific job categories, we have also considered various criteria such as experience and education.

Profession Ensign, repository has the SSYK code 110, which we use to match against the SCB database to obtain the latest salary statistics.
